M. Kuhn, P. Hopchev, M. Ferro-Luzzi

Slides:



Advertisements
Similar presentations
Impact parameter studies with early data from ATLAS
Advertisements

Properties of Least Squares Regression Coefficients
Multiplicity analysis and dN/d  reconstruction with the silicon pixel detector Terzo Convegno Nazionale sulla Fisica di ALICE Frascati (Italy) – November.
LHCb PatVeloTT Performance Adam Webber. Why Upgrade?  Currently we de-focus the beams o LHCb Luminosity ~ 2x10 32 cm -2 s -1 o ~ 1 interaction per bunch.
June 6 th, 2011 N. Cartiglia 1 “Measurement of the pp inelastic cross section using pile-up events with the CMS detector” How to use pile-up.
1 Vertex fitting Zeus student seminar May 9, 2003 Erik Maddox NIKHEF/UvA.
Kevin Black Meenakshi Narain Boston University
In order to acquire the full physics potential of the LHC, the ATLAS electromagnetic calorimeter must be able to efficiently identify photons and electrons.
MonteCarlo simulation of neutrino interactions in PEANUT Giovanni De Lellis on behalf of Alberto Marotta and Andrea Russo Naples University.
Reconstruction of neutrino interactions in PEANUT G.D.L., Andrea Russo, Luca Scotto Lavina Naples University.
Contalbrigo Marco INFN Ferrara CLAS Transverse Target Meeting 4th March, 2010 Frascati.
The LiC Detector Toy M. Valentan, M. Regler, R. Frühwirth Austrian Academy of Sciences Institute of High Energy Physics, Vienna InputSimulation ReconstructionOutput.
PPR meeting - January 23, 2003 Andrea Dainese 1 TPC tracking parameterization: a useful tool for simulation studies with large statistics Motivation Implementation.
Pion test beam from KEK: momentum studies Data provided by Toho group: 2512 beam tracks D. Duchesneau April 27 th 2011 Track  x Track  y Base track positions.
Measurement of through-going particle momentum by means of Multiple Scattering with the T600 TPC Talk given by Antonio Jesús Melgarejo (Universidad de.
1 Track reconstruction and physics analysis in LHCb Outline Introduction to the LHCb experiment Track reconstruction → finding and fitting Physics analysis.
TWIST Measuring the Space-Time Structure of Muon Decay Carl Gagliardi Texas A&M University TWIST Collaboration Physics of TWIST Introduction to the Experiment.
W  eν The W->eν analysis is a phi uniformity calibration, and only yields relative calibration constants. This means that all of the α’s in a given eta.
Tracking at LHCb Introduction: Tracking Performance at LHCb Kalman Filter Technique Speed Optimization Status & Plans.
Irakli Chakaberia Final Examination April 28, 2014.
TWIST A Precision Measurement of Muon Decay at TRIUMF Peter Kitching TRIUMF/University of Alberta TWIST Collaboration Physics of TWIST Introduction to.
Impact parameter resolution study for ILC detector Tomoaki Fujikawa (Tohoku university) ACFA Workshop in Taipei Nov
Prompt J/  and b ➝ J/  X production in pp collisions at LHCb Patrick Robbe, LAL Orsay & CERN, 7 Dec 2010 For the LHCb Collaboration KRUGER 2010 Workshop.
Optimization of parameters for jet finding algorithm for p+p collisions at E cm =200 GeV T. G. Dedovich & M.V. Tokarev JINR, Dubna  Motivations.
Track extrapolation to TOF with Kalman filter F. Pierella for the TOF-Offline Group INFN & Bologna University PPR Meeting, January 2003.
1 Energy loss correction for a crystal calorimeter He Miao Institute of High Energy Physics Beijing, P.R.China.
Mitglied der Helmholtz-Gemeinschaft Calibration of the COSY-TOF STT & pp Elastic Analysis Sedigheh Jowzaee IKP Group Talk 11 July 2013.
August 26, 2003P. Nilsson, SPD Group Meeting1 Paul Nilsson, SPD Group Meeting, August 26, 2003 Test Beam 2002 Analysis Techniques for Estimating Intrinsic.
Tracking, PID and primary vertex reconstruction in the ITS Elisabetta Crescio-INFN Torino.
Determination of True Attenuation Lengths using SPASE-AMANDA Coincidence Data Tim Miller JHU/APL.
Energy Scan of Hadron (  0 ) Suppression and Flow in Au+Au Collisions at PHENIX Norbert Novitzky for PHENIX collaboration University of Jyväskylä, Finland.
Tracking in High Density Environment
Study of exclusive radiative B decays with LHCb Galina Pakhlova, (ITEP, Moscow) for LHCb collaboration Advanced Study Institute “Physics at LHC”, LHC Praha-2003,
1 DT Local Reconstruction on CRAFT data Plots for approval CMS- Run meeting, 26/6/09 U.Gasparini, INFN & Univ.Padova on behalf of DT community [ n.b.:
D 0 reconstruction: 15 AGeV – 25 AGeV – 35 AGeV M.Deveaux, C.Dritsa, F.Rami IPHC Strasbourg / GSI Darmstadt Outline Motivation Simulation Tools Results.
A track fitting method for multiple scattering Peter Kvasnička, 5th SILC meeting, Prague 2007.
Kalanand Mishra June 29, Branching Ratio Measurements of Decays D 0  π - π + π 0, D 0  K - K + π 0 Relative to D 0  K - π + π 0 Giampiero Mancinelli,
Giuseppe Ruggiero CERN Straw Chamber WG meeting 07/02/2011 Spectrometer Reconstruction: Pattern recognition and Efficiency 07/02/ G.Ruggiero - Spectrometer.
LiC Detector Toy Liverpool SiLC MeetingM. Regler, M. Valentan, R. FrühwirthLiverpool SiLC MeetingM. Regler, M. Valentan, R. Frühwirth The LiC Detector.
Particle identification by energy loss measurement in the NA61 (SHINE) experiment Magdalena Posiadala University of Warsaw.
Paolo Massarotti Kaon meeting March 2007  ±  X    X  Time measurement use neutral vertex only in order to obtain a completely independent.
Outline Description of the experimental setup Aim of this work TDC spectra analysis Tracking method steps Autocalibration Single tube resolution Summary.
Measurement of the Muon Charge Ratio in Cosmic Ray Events with the CMS Experiment at the LHC S. Marcellini, INFN Bologna – Italy on behalf of the CMS collaboration.
INFN - PadovaBeauty Measurements in pp with the Central Detector 1 Beauty Measurements in p-p with the Central Detector F. Antinori, C. Bombonati, A. Dainese,
Iterative local  2 alignment algorithm for the ATLAS Pixel detector Tobias Göttfert IMPRS young scientists workshop 17 th July 2006.
1 Azimuthal angle fluctuations (draft of NA49 publication) NA61/SHINE and NA49 Software/Analysis meeting February 15 th – 18 th, WUT Katarzyna Grebieszkow.
Yet another approach to the ToF-based PID at PANDA
The MiniBooNE Little Muon Counter Detector
Dmitry Emeliyanov, Rutherford Appleton Laboratory
Using IP Chi-Square Probability
Ex1: Event Generation (Binomial Distribution)
Offline meeting Azimuthally sensitive Hanbury-Brown-Twiss (HBT) Interferometry Lukasz Graczykowski Warsaw University of Technology Johanna.
Beam Gas Vertex – Beam monitor
Charles F. Maguire Vanderbilt University
Studies for Phase-II Muon Detector (|η| = ) – Plans
Results of dN/dt Elastic
Vertex and Kinematic fitting with Pandaroot
Simple Linear Regression - Introduction
Statistics Review ChE 477 Winter 2018 Dr. Harding.
Unfolding Problem: A Machine Learning Approach
Introduction to Instrumentation Engineering
Event Shape Analysis in minimum bias pp collisions in ALICE.
Charged Particle Multiplicity in DIS
Prospects for quarkonium studies at LHCb
The LHCb Level 1 trigger LHC Symposium, October 27, 2001
Contents First section: pion and proton misidentification probabilities as Loose or Tight Muons. Measurements using Jet-triggered data (from run).
Slope measurements from test-beam irradiations
Unfolding with system identification
Measurement of b-jet Shapes at CDF
Presentation transcript:

M. Kuhn, P. Hopchev, M. Ferro-Luzzi BGV Vertex Resolution First Analysis Toy Monte Carlo Simulations Fast Vertex Fitting Algorithm M. Kuhn, P. Hopchev, M. Ferro-Luzzi

Motivation Analysis of vertex resolution with simulated beam-gas interactions in model detector Accuracy of measured beam size smeas limited by vertex resolution First estimation of vertex resolution svtx To determine precisely real beam size sbeam To minimize systematic uncertainty: But more important is the precise knowledge of svtx! Vertex resolution needs to be studies as Function of z-position in the vertices Function of number of tracks in the vertex

Introduction Input: original vertex and detector volume Toy Monte Carlo simulation of propagated tracks through detector material Reconstruction of original vertex LHCb fast vertex fitting algorithm Comparison of original and reconstructed vertex BGV vertex resolution As function of number of tracks As function of z-position …

Input Original vertex Detector volume Generated with HIJING (in the LHCb simulation application GAUSS) Neon target Flat distribution of events in z-range [-500;500] mm Each event contains a single beam-gas interaction Detector volume 4 sensitive planes (2 detector modules at z = 1591 mm and z = 2611 mm) x and y spatial resolution = 72 mm (Gaussian smeared) one module = 1.6 % of radiation length exit window thickness is constant with r and corresponds to x/X0 = 1.5 % We used the HIJING generator available in the simulation application (GAUSS) of LHCb. This is what "hi" is for (it could be pythia for example). The "10" in the filename indicates the Z of the target gas, so Neon, which we plan to inject in practice. The last number in the filename is the beam energy. There are different possibilities to specify the longitudinal distribution of the vertices in the simulation. In the ".dat" files above the events have a flat distribution in the range [-500;500] mm. The pressure is not an input parameter, we specify that each "event" contains a single beam-gas interaction (alternatively, we could generate Poisson). The "sensitive planes" represent the detector modules at a specific z. In the geometry description file, the "first" plane is at z = 1591 mm, and the "second" is at z = 2611 mm. The distance between them is the "lever arm" which determines the "extrapolation error". For more details, you can use the "boolDrawDetector" switch in bgv.py and also look at the contents of the detector description file. Spatial resolution = Gaussian smeared

Toy Monte Carlo Simulation Algorithm Track propagation (multiple scattering in traversed material) Smearing of measured points with detector resolution Track and vertex fitting Example: one event with 8 tracks (7 TeV) Simulated 8000 events with a total of 277,383 tracks (more events = more tracks), of which 5581 events are treated for MC simulation Average fraction of accepted and fitted tracks: 0.23 The ToyMC is completely standalone, no LHCb SW involved. The "algorithm" consists of several parts: track propagation, taking into account the multiple scattering in the traversed material, smearing of the measured points with the detector resolution, track fitting, vertex fitting. Expected number of good events: 6891 of 8000 = 0.86 Observed number of good events: 5581 of 8000 = 0.70 This is the average number of generated tracks compared with the average fraction of accepted and fitted tracks (look up in python script) Defined by detector layout

LHCb Fast Vertex Fitting Algorithm Calculate the distance between primary and secondary vertex Assuming a linear interpolation For each track i the equations are xi(z) = x0i + mxi z x0i and y0i are coordinates at z = 0 yi(z) = y0i + myi z mx,y are slopes in x-z and y-z plane Coordinates of the best fitted vertex (vx, vy, vz) are found by minimizing the c2 function (no uncertainties of the track on z-position) sxi and syi are obtained from the track covariance matrix LHCb 2005-013

Vertex Reconstruction Comparison of primary and reconstructed vertex Calculate residuals: primary vertex – reconstructed vertex Fit with Gauss function: s = Vertex Resolution Goal: minimize s and m Primary vertex from MC simulation Resolution should be energy independent At 450 GeV injection energy the distribution of residuals is wider consider not fitting the tails Also less events with high number of tracks for lower energies! not enough statistics for good fit

Vertex Resolution vs. Number of Tracks (I) Procedure: Plot vertex resolution according to #tracks per vertex Fit with 3 parameter Gauss function to obtain the resolution s per #tracks Example:

Vertex Resolution vs. Number of Tracks (II) Spread of m and error increases with more #tracks Resolution improves with more #tracks, but larger errors due to less statistics!

Vertex Resolution vs. Number of Tracks (III) Resolution in all 3 planes improves with large #tracks But fitting is impossible at ~ 20 tracks/vertex!!! Need more statistics (larger number of events) Need to define indication for bad fits to discard them For fitting bin the number of tracks Expected transverse beam sizes in the LHC: sx,y ~ 600 mm at 450 GeV for enorm = 1 mm & b = 170 m Expected transverse beam sizes in the LHC: sx,y ~ 180 mm at 7 TeV for enorm = 1.5 mm & b = 170 m

Vertex Resolution vs. Number of Tracks (IV) Binning of residuals and number of tracks in intervals of [5 ; 8], [9 ; 12], [13 ; 16], [17 ; 20], [ > 20] #tracks Fit with 3 parameter Gauss function to obtain the resolution s per track bin Expected transverse beam sizes in the LHC: sx,y ~ 180 mm at 7 TeV for enorm = 1.5 mm & b = 170 m 5 | 8 | 12 | 16 | 19 |>20 #tracks

Distribution of Vertex z-Position Distribution of original z-position as function of #tracks Distribution of reconstructed z-position as function of #tracks very similar Binning of z-positions in 200 mm intervals bin 0| bin 1| bin 2| bin 3| bin 4

Vertex Resolution vs z-Position (I) Procedure: Bin and plot vertex resolution according to z-position per vertex Fit with 3 parameter Gauss function to obtain the resolution s per interval of z- positions

Vertex Resolution vs. z-Position (II) Transverse planes: vertex resolution varies only slightly Very small dependency on z-position for x and y resolution Longitudinal plane: vertex resolution depends on z-position Best resolution for z > 100 mm -500|-300|-100|100|300|500 z [mm]

Summary Exponential decrease of resolution in all planes Accuracy of measured beam size limited by vertex resolution Therefore vertex resolution needs to be determined very precisely Analysis of vertex resolution via simulated beam-gas interaction Tracking with toy Monte Carlo simulation LHCb Fast Vertex Fitting Algorithm Vertex Resolution of model detector As function of number of tracks: Exponential decrease of resolution in all planes Best resolution for high number of tracks As function of original z-position: Best resolution for z > 100 mm (Interaction point closest to detector modules)

To Do List Vertex resolution for variable window thickness Vertex resolution as function of beam pipe radius To investigate if reduction of aperture is needed Deconvolve the vertex resolution and determine the true beam size Test vertex fitting algorithm in ROOT Improve vertex fitting algorithm (assuming 0.4 GeV/c transverse momentum and knowledge of material distribution to make Kalman filter) On the TO DO (future, medium-term ?): implement a better vtx algorithm that uses assumption of 0.4 GeV/c transverse momentum (which is a mean) and knowledge of material distribution to make a sort of Kalman filter (should improve vtx resolution ? to be studied...). Here we will have to weigh resolution vs timing performance... The Kalman filter, also known as linear quadratic estimation (LQE), is an algorithm that uses a series of measurements observed over time, containing noise (random variations) and other inaccuracies, and produces estimates of unknown variables that tend to be more precise than those based on a single measurement alone. More formally, the Kalman filter operates recursively on streams of noisy input data to produce a statistically optimal estimate of the underlying system state.